中文版
 

Understanding CVE-2025-21043: A Critical Zero-Day Vulnerability and Its Implications

2025-09-12 15:45:38 Reads: 38
Explores CVE-2025-21043, a critical Android vulnerability and its implications for users.

Understanding CVE-2025-21043: A Critical Zero-Day Vulnerability and Its Implications

In the ever-evolving landscape of cybersecurity, vulnerabilities in software can lead to significant risks for users and organizations alike. Recently, Samsung addressed a critical security vulnerability identified as CVE-2025-21043, which has been exploited in zero-day attacks against Android devices. This article will delve into the intricacies of this vulnerability, its implications for users, and how such vulnerabilities are generally managed in the tech industry.

What is CVE-2025-21043?

CVE-2025-21043 is classified as a critical vulnerability with a CVSS score of 8.8, indicating a high severity level. The core issue lies in an "out-of-bounds write" in the `libimagecodec.quram.so` library, which is a component involved in image processing on Android devices. An out-of-bounds write occurs when a program writes data outside the allocated memory space, potentially leading to arbitrary code execution. This means that an attacker could exploit this vulnerability to execute malicious code on the affected device, compromising its integrity and security.

The implications of such vulnerabilities are profound. Attackers can gain unauthorized access to sensitive data, hijack device functionality, or even create botnets by compromising numerous devices. The fact that this vulnerability has been exploited in real-world attacks highlights the urgency for users to apply security updates promptly.

How the Vulnerability Works in Practice

To understand how CVE-2025-21043 can be exploited, it's essential to consider the context in which the vulnerability exists. The `libimagecodec.quram.so` library is responsible for handling image data, which is a common operation across many apps on Android devices. When an application processes an image, it might not adequately validate the data size or type being processed. If an attacker can manipulate this input (for instance, by sending a specially crafted image file), they may trigger the out-of-bounds write condition.

Once the vulnerability is triggered, the attacker can control the execution flow of the program. This could lead to various malicious outcomes, including the installation of malware, unauthorized data access, or other harmful actions. Such exploits often occur without the user's knowledge, making them particularly dangerous.

Underlying Principles of Software Vulnerabilities

The situation surrounding CVE-2025-21043 brings to light several key principles about software vulnerabilities and open-source software development.

1. Memory Management: The out-of-bounds write error is a common issue in programming languages that allow direct memory manipulation, such as C or C++. Proper memory management techniques and thorough testing can help mitigate such vulnerabilities.

2. Input Validation: One of the most effective ways to prevent exploits is through rigorous input validation. Ensuring that any data received from users or external sources is checked for correctness and safety can significantly reduce the risk of vulnerabilities being exploited.

3. Timely Updates and Patching: The response from Samsung illustrates the importance of timely software updates. Regular patches help protect devices from known vulnerabilities and should be a routine part of any security strategy for both consumers and enterprises.

4. Community Awareness and Reporting: The existence of a CVE (Common Vulnerabilities and Exposures) entry signifies that the vulnerability has been acknowledged and documented. This transparency is crucial for developers and security professionals, enabling them to implement appropriate measures and stay informed about potential threats.

Conclusion

The discovery and subsequent patching of CVE-2025-21043 serve as a critical reminder of the ongoing challenges faced in cybersecurity. Users must remain vigilant, ensuring their devices are updated regularly to safeguard against such vulnerabilities. As technology continues to advance, understanding these vulnerabilities not only empowers users but also fosters a culture of security awareness that is essential in today’s digital world. By implementing robust security practices and staying informed, we can collectively mitigate the risks posed by such vulnerabilities and enhance our overall cybersecurity posture.

 
Scan to use notes to record any inspiration
© 2024 ittrends.news  Contact us
Bear's Home  Three Programmer  Investment Edge